What is Vacate Cleaning?

Bond cleaning, also referred to as bond cleaning, is a thorough cleaning of the property before returning it to the real estate agent. Unlike standard cleaning, this involves intensive scrubbing of every section of the house to ensure it meets the lease agreement standards.

What Needs to Be Cleaned?

• Living Areas & Bedrooms: Wiping down furniture, deep-cleaning floors, washing window panes, and removing cobwebs.
• Kitchen: Removing grease from cooktops, sanitizing baking appliances, disinfecting work surfaces, and sanitizing basins.
• Washrooms & Restrooms: Scrubbing tiles, wiping down sinks, removing toilet stains, and eliminating limescale.
• Walls & Floors: Wiping down walls, scrubbing flooring, and sanitizing carpets if required.
• Window Frames & Handles: Cleaning window panes, wiping down door handles, and shining reflective surfaces.

How to Clean Before Moving Out

If you prefer to clean the property yourself, follow these useful tips:
• Use effective cleaning products to get a deeper clean.
• Start cleaning from ceilings first to avoid redoing work.
• Pay special attention to kitchens, as these rooms are highly checked.
• Consider renting a carpet shampooer for carpets if necessary to remove stains.
